- Вступление. Книги, ПО, ресурсы.
- Системы управления версиями. Git.
- Работа с проектом
- Java (JVM, GIT, gc, SE, EE)
- Принципы ООП
- Объектная модель и классы Java.
- Работа со строками.
- Массивы.
- Аннотации.
- Модульное тестирование (JUnit).
- Отражение (Reflection)
- Исключения
- Логирование.
- Контейнеры/коллекции.
- Вложенные, внутренние, локальные и анонимные классы.
- Java 8. Lambda и Stream API.
- Параметризация. Стирание типов.
- Работа с файлами. Ввод/вывод.
- Сериализация.
- Работа с XML.
- Работа с JSON.
- Потоки.
- Параллельное выполнение. JMM
- Веб-Контейнер Tomcat.
- Сервлеты.
- JSP. JSTL
- SQL. Реляционная СУБД.
- JDBC
- Транзакции.
- Загрузчик классов.
- Обзор Java фреймворков.
- Обзор Java EE.
redison4ik/JavaSE-course
Folders and files
| Name | Name | Last commit date | ||
|---|---|---|---|---|